Encode Engine graph is not exposed in Task Manager for Intel Graphics

Description

Windows Task Manager can show 'Video Decode', 'Video Decode 1', 'Video processing' and others but there is no option to show Video Encoder graph.

Resolution

This is expected behavior as Intel graphics chips can have one or two video command streamer (VCS) engines and one video enhancement (VE) engine.

The VE node handles post-processing tasks and the VCS engines handle both encode and decode workloads; but since we can only report one node type to the Operating System (OS) for each engine the OS labels them "Video Decode" and "Video Decode 1"

Therefore Video Decode 1 equals to Video Encode.
